Emerging trends in deep learning:
In this data-driven world, data privacy is a serious concern. Federated learning is a new concept in deep learning that can collaborate multiple devices on a single model, restricting the share of data with a central server. Therefore, this approach reduces the risk of data breaches. Furthermore, federated learning also minimizes the need for storing and computing data, as a huge amount of data rests on the devices. This innovative technology has immense potential to drive the deep learning market with lucrative investment opportunities.
Another interesting trend in deep learning is explainable AI (XAI) which can actively enhance the transparency and cognizance of deep learning models. It is essential for advanced AI systems to make fair decisions. XAI can leverage the capability of AI systems with improved accountability, leading to better decision-making processes. This added feature of AI systems can be beneficial for various applications in different fields, such as finance, autonomous vehicles, and healthcare, where accuracy and transparency are paramount.

Product launches:
Owing to the increasing demand for easy deployment of deep learning models across industries, many leading players have come up with favorable product launches. A notable example is the launch of SuperGradients, an “all-in-one" deep learning training library for computer vision models by Deci, a leading deep learning development company coupling artificial intelligence (AI). This library would enable AI developers to get trained with common computer vision tasks such as image classification, object detection, and semantic segmentation.
